Artzer, Mary Catherine
Department of Public Management and Policy, Ph.D. Student
Mary Catherine is a second-year PhD student in Public Policy. Her current research interests focus on transportation policy, including how the built environment impacts people’s transportation decisions (or removes any decision capabilities) and how that intersects with sustainability, health outcomes, and equity. She holds a bachelor’s degree in International Economics and Spanish from Rhodes College. Following her undergraduate degree, she worked at various consulting firms as a research analyst and project manager in the private sector. She currently serves as a graduate research assistant for Dr. Ann-Margaret Esnard working on adaptive capacity in the face of multi-hazard events.
